Android网络小说爬虫工具:基于jsoup和xpath的CrawlerForReader项目
1. 项目基础介绍
CrawlerForReader 是一个开源的Android本地网络小说爬虫项目,基于Java语言和jsoup库,同时使用了xpath技术进行网页数据的解析。该项目旨在为用户提供一个简单易用的工具,通过爬取网络小说网站的内容,帮助用户在本地阅读器中阅读。
2. 项目核心功能
项目的核心功能包括:
- 多书源支持:CrawlerForReader 支持多个网络小说网站的书源,用户可以根据需要选择不同的网站进行书籍的搜索和下载。
- 模板解析:通过配置不同的xpath模板,项目能够适应不同网站的结构,解析出书籍的名称、作者、描述和目录等信息。
- 目录和内容爬取:支持书籍目录的爬取以及章节内容的获取,用户可以方便地下载并阅读完整的小说。
- 异步请求:虽然请求结果通过Callback形式返回,但内部实现了同步请求,保证了数据的一致性和准确性。
3. 项目最近更新的功能
最近更新的功能主要包括:
- 性能优化:对爬虫的效率和响应时间进行了优化,提高了用户体验。
- 错误处理:增强了错误处理机制,确保在爬取过程中遇到问题能够及时反馈并处理。
- 模板更新:随着网络小说网站结构的更新,对部分书源的解析模板进行了调整,确保解析的正确性。
- 用户界面:对用户界面进行了微调,使操作更加直观和便捷。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



